Description de notre maison d'échange
We have a fully equipped bungalow situated on one acre on a private road on the Northumberland Strait. It is 15 minutes away from the town of Pictou where all services are available, and the same distance to the ferry to Prince Edward Island. It is within a small friendly community of cottages and year-round houses, but private with amazing ocean views and unforgettable sunrises and sunsets. In May and June lobster fishing occurs in front of the house, and later in the year there are herring and scallop fisheries. There are farmers' markets in New Glasgow and Tatamagouche about 25 minutes away and many historic and artisan attractions within a short drive.

Description de notre quartier et ses alentours
Quiet and friendly community of 11 homes in rural setting on private road next to the ocean. It is 15 minutes to the town of Pictou, 25 minutes to the City of New Glasgow. Toney River harbour, a few minutes away via the Sunrise Trail, is used by the local fishing fleet. River John, 10 km the other away, has many amenities including a post office, pharmacy, liquor store, gas station, convenience store and a distillery. There are medical facilities in Tatamagouche (25 minutes) and in New Glasgow.
